開発環境でメールの動作確認をする際にmailtrapを使用しているのですが、設定に迷うことがあったので、備忘録としてまとめていきます。
前提
mailtrapへのサインアップが済んでいる
設定
InboxesのDemo inboxが作成されています。これの歯車をクリックすると設定する項目を確認することができます。
ページへ遷移するとcredentialとサンプルコードがあるので、自身の環境にあったコードがあれば、そのままコピペしたら動作します。
自分の場合は、fuelphpだったので、それを選択して、貼り付けました。
return array(
'driver' => 'smtp',
'smtp' => array(
'host' => 'smtp.mailtrap.io',
'port' => 2525,
'username' => 'xxxxxxxxxxxxxx',
'password' => 'xxxxxxxxxxxxxx',
'timeout' => 5
),
'newline' => "\r\n"
);
まとめ
usernameとpasswordがどこで確認できるのか忘れることがあったので、まとめてみました。
誰かの参考になれば幸いです。